59:1  To the choirmaster: according to Do Not Destroy. A Miktam of David, when Saul sent men to watch his house in order to kill him. Deliver me from my enemies, O my God; protect me from those who rise up against me;
59:2  deliver me from those who work evil, and save me from bloodthirsty men.
59:3  For behold, they lie in wait for my life; fierce men stir up strife against me. For no transgression or sin of mine, O LORD,
59:4  for no fault of mine, they run and make ready. Awake, come to meet me, and see!
59:5  You, LORD God of hosts, are God of Israel. Rouse yourself to punish all the nations; spare none of those who treacherously plot evil. Selah
59:6  Each evening they come back, howling like dogs and prowling about the city.
59:7  There they are, bellowing with their mouths with swords in their lips— for “Who,” they think, “will hear us?”
59:8  But you, O LORD, laugh at them; you hold all the nations in derision.
59:9  O my Strength, I will watch for you, for you, O God, are my fortress.
59:10  My God in his steadfast love will meet me; God will let me look in triumph on my enemies.
59:11  Kill them not, lest my people forget; make them totter by your power and bring them down, O Lord, our shield!
59:12  For the sin of their mouths, the words of their lips, let them be trapped in their pride. For the cursing and lies that they utter,
59:13  consume them in wrath; consume them till they are no more, that they may know that God rules over Jacob to the ends of the earth. Selah
59:14  Each evening they come back, howling like dogs and prowling about the city.
59:15  They wander about for food and growl if they do not get their fill.
59:16  But I will sing of your strength; I will sing aloud of your steadfast love in the morning. For you have been to me a fortress and a refuge in the day of my distress.
59:17  O my Strength, I will sing praises to you, for you, O God, are my fortress, the God who shows me steadfast love.
